別の列の末尾の行に基づいて pandas データフレームで計算を行うことは可能ですか? このようなもの。
frame = pd.DataFrame({'a' : [True, False, True, False],
'b' : [25, 22, 55, 35]})
出力を次のようにしたい:
A B C
True 25
False 22 44
True 55 55
False 35 70
列 A の末尾の行が False の場合、列 C は列 B と同じで、列 A の末尾の行が True の場合、列 C は列 B * 2ですか?